Position Summary :
Individual would have responsibility for development and validation of critical materials technologies, processes and suppliers supporting innovative HVAC applications across Carrier. They would be responsible for initial technology characterization and development through implementation and scale-up production. This includes both conducting or coordination of materials evaluations, interpretation of data, development of models and communication of results.
This position will require development of novel methods and techniques to characterize materials not previously considered within the HVAC industry. It will involve working with new suppliers and industries, as well as universities and consortiums to assist in identifying new research and materials for consideration. Coordination of activities across disciplines within Carrier will also be necessary to ensure the proper application of materials and processes. Within the Advanced Materials Engineering team, working with subject matter experts and test engineers and technicians will be needed to ensure the proper considerations are taken in evaluation of new materials and that these considerations are implemented in the characterization of said materials.
